Overview

Postcode TR12 6BG is located in an urban city, within the Helston South & Meneage ward of Cornwall in the South West region, and forms part of the The Lizard area. It has high deprivation and low crime levels, with around 40.2 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, about 53% below the South West average of 85 per 1,000. The average income per household in The Lizard is £45,658 per year. The nearest station is Penmere, about 7.4 miles away. There are 1 primary and no secondary schools in the area.

Property prices in Helston South & Meneage

Median price£260,250
Price per sq ft£306
Sales (last 12 months)94
Typical range (middle 50%)£184K – £401K

Based on 94 recent sales, the median property price is £260,250 (about £306 per square foot) in Helston South & Meneage area, with individual transactions ranging from £30,000 up to £1,650,000.
